Size Matters
One of the most important factors to consider when choosing a bucket for cleaning supplies is the size. The size of the bucket you choose will depend on the size of the area you are cleaning and the amount of supplies you need to carry. If you have a large area to clean or many supplies to haul around, a larger bucket is probably the way to go. However, if you have limited space or only need to carry a few supplies, a smaller bucket may be more practical.
Material
Another crucial factor to consider when choosing a bucket for cleaning supplies is the material it is made of. Plastic buckets are the most common choice for cleaning supplies because they are lightweight, durable, and easy to clean. However, if you are dealing with harsh chemicals or hot water, you may want to consider a bucket made of a more durable material like stainless steel or aluminum.
Features
When shopping for a bucket for cleaning supplies, it’s essential to consider the features that will make your cleaning tasks more manageable. Look for a bucket with a sturdy handle that is comfortable to hold, as well as one with a spout for easy pouring. Some buckets also come with compartments or trays for organizing your supplies, which can be a handy feature to have.
Color Coding
If you are using different cleaning solutions for various areas of your home or office, you may want to consider color-coding your buckets. This way, you can quickly grab the right bucket for the job without having to guess or risk mixing chemicals. Using different colored buckets can also help prevent cross-contamination and ensure that you are using the right cleaner for each task.
Storage
When not in use, your bucket for cleaning supplies will need a place to be stored. Consider where you will be keeping your bucket and choose one that will fit in your storage space. Some buckets are stackable, which can save you space if you need to store multiple buckets. Others come with lids to keep your supplies secure and prevent spills when not in use.
Durability
Lastly, when choosing a bucket for cleaning supplies, it’s essential to consider the durability of the bucket. You want a bucket that will hold up to frequent use and won’t crack or break easily. Look for a bucket with reinforced edges and a thick bottom to prevent damage from heavy loads. It’s also a good idea to choose a bucket with a warranty in case it does break or wear out prematurely.
